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Teddington to Merthyr Vale start from as little as £27.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Teddington to Merthyr Vale start from £57.10 one way, or £99.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Teddington to Merthyr Vale are available for £149.50 one way, or £299.00 return

Facilities and Amenities at Teddington Station

Teddington Train Station is equipped with various amenities designed to make your travel experience comfortable and easy. The ticket office operates from the early hours (06:40) well into the evening (20:25) on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 08:45 to 18:00 on Sundays. This ensures you have ample opportunity to purchase or collect tickets at your convenience. Additionally, there are ticket machines, including accessible options for those with a Disabled Persons Railcard, enabling you to collect tickets bought online effortlessly.

While the station does not offer luggage storage or many shopping options, you will find a delightful coffee shop on Platform 2 that promises tasty refreshments for your journey. Furthermore, the station is equipped with CCTV and an induction loop, ensuring both security and accessibility for all passengers. It’s important to note, however, that there are no accessible parking spaces at the moment.

Facilities and Amenities

Though the station lacks a ticket office, fear not; ticket machines are readily available for purchasing and collecting tickets, ensuring a seamless experience as you embark on your journey. The station is equipped with accessible ticket machines and an induction loop, enhancing the experience for passengers with specific needs. However, amenities such as waiting rooms, toilets, and refreshment facilities are unfortunately absent. For assistance or inquiries, you’ll find helpful information points complemented by CCTV surveillance for safety.
